    So my 3 year old daughter has a key, which is connected to my phone. My husband wants to take her to disneyland one day without me, but her key is connected to my account not his. I was wondering if I could connect her key to both accounts or screenshot it

    Hey there, hi there, Ashley! Thanks so much for stopping by planDisney to ask us your question. 

    I love hearing that your husband wants to take your daughter on a special day to Disneyland Resort soon. I have good news, you can do either! You could screenshot her Magic Key Pass barcode to share with him to scan her in. You could also share her Magic Key Pass number with him and he could add it to his Disney account. Tickets and Passes can be added to more than one account without any issues.
